They were coming off a 2019 season in which they made a run all the way to the championship game. Nobody in Vian had expectations of anything less than a return trip to Wantland Stadium. Covid certainly threw some curveballs at the Wolverines. After dominating wins in week zero and week one, they had their week two game with Lincoln Christian get cancelled. Because of that, the Wolverines scrambled and still had a game that Friday night. Late Thursday morning, Vian agreed to travel to Oklahoma City to take on John Marshall in a game that would take place about 30 hours later. That evening, the Wolverines would prevail in a very entertaining 32-28 victory. Covid caused some very interesting match-up’s and scheduling decisions and this was a perfect example of that. Vian would go on to dominate their district, with the exception of an upset loss on the road to Cascia Hall. Because of the loss to Cascia, Vian would finish in second place and have to face Metro Christian in a championship rematch earlier than expected. They would lose to the Patriots for the second straight year and finish 9-2. The Wolverines aren't coming off a championship game appearance coming into this season but expectations remain the same. Despite only having eight starters back total from last year's team, Vian should be considered one of the top teams in Class 2A as they come in at #10 in our 2A rankings. Vian is obviously a run-first team so they didn’t ask Ramos to use his arm as much as being creative in the running game. Ramos is also a standout baseball player and could end up being one of the best baseball prospects in the state’s 2023 class. However, on the football field, he’s going to end up being a four-year starter for the Wolverines and will be a steady presence on an offense that will have some new faces this fall. We expect Ramos to take that next step this fall as a QB. <strong>[player_tooltip player_id="61124" first="Xavin" last="Lackey"] - 2022 Linebacker</strong> Vian’s [player_tooltip player_id="61124" first="Xavin" last="Lackey"] is one of the best overall linebackers in the state. He’s without a doubt the highest rated Vian prospect when it comes to our recruiting rankings. Lackey has been a dominating force on this Vian defense for over two years now. He has over 200 tackles in the last two seasons and is ready to step into the spotlight this season. Vian has had a star on their defense with defensive lineman [player_tooltip player_id="38502" first="Solomon" last="Wright"] for the last few years. Now, it’s Lackey’s turn to step into that role and be the can’t miss player on this exciting defensive unit. From 2015-2019, the Wolverines had won at least ten games in each season. Their streak of five straight seasons of at least ten wins came to an end last year in the playoffs when they lost to Metro Christian. They had their season ended by the Patriots for the second consecutive season. In 2019, it was in the title game, last year, it was in the third round. Vian did keep a streak going during the shortened season last year. For the 10th consecutive season, Vian won at least one playoff game. The Wolverines have been one of the best and consistent teams in Class 2A over the last decade. The only thing that is waiting for them is a state championship. During that decade stretch, they’ve only made it to one state championship game. Class 2A is once again going to be very competitive this year and Vian will still be one of those championship contenders. Before last year’s week two game was cancelled due to Covid, they had played in 2018 and 2019. Both meetings were decided by single digits with Lincoln getting the win on both occasions. The Bulldogs have gotten into the habit of facing off with Class 2A’s best in non-district play. They have Beggs, Jones and Vian on their schedule, all ranked in the top ten. For Vian, this wraps up a tough non-district schedule as well. The Wolverines will counter Lincoln’s high-flying offense with a ground and pound game. It would be Vian’s only regular season loss and they fell 7-6. In the five other district games, Vian outscored their opponents 302-19 in those games with a pair of shutouts. Cascia Hall will have some new faces but the defense will still be talented and this match-up last year was a defensive stalemate. The Wolverines will get Cascia at home this time around and the district championship will more than likely be decided right here as these teams are the heavy favorites.
